Provincial Court Land Records, 1749-1756
Volume 701, Page 406   View pdf image

406)

       To the Intent and Purpose only that the said James shall and may become
       perfect Tenant of the Freehold of the said Messuage Tenement Lands & Premisses
       and shall and may stand and be Seized thereof untill a good and perfect
       Common Recovery with double Vouchers over may be duly had suffered and
       Executed of the said Messuage Tenements Lands and Premisses according to the
       Usual Course of Common Recoverys for the Assurance of Lands and Tenements
       in such Cases Used and Accustomed And thereupon it is Covenanted Concluded
       and Agreed by and between the Parties to these presents for themselves and their
       and every of their Heirs by these Presents in manner following (that is to say)
       That the said James Tilghman shall and will before the end of September Term
       next coming permit and suffer the said Edward Tilghman to sue forth & prosecute
       against ^him^ the said James one Writ of Entry sur Disseisin en le Post returnable before
       his Lordships Justices of the Provincial Court at Annapolis thereby Demanding
       against the said James Tilghman the said Messuage Tenements Lands & Premisses
       herein before mentioned by such Name and Names Number of Acres Quantities
       Qualities Terms and Descriptions in the said Writ to be Contained and in such
       manner and form as by Councel Learned in the Law shall be Advised, unto and
       upon which said Writ of Entry so to be Prosecuted and Sued forth the said James
       shall appear Gratis and Vouch to Warranty the said Nicholas and Mary
       which said Nicholas and Mary shall appear either in Person or by Attorney
       Lawfully Authorized and enter into Warranty and after their Entry into Warranty
       shall Vouch to Warranty the Common Vouchee who shall likewise appear
       and Imparle and afterwards make default and depart in Contempt of the
       Court so that Judgment may be thereupon had and given for the said Edward
       to Recover the said Messuage Tenement Lands and Premisses against the said
       James and for the said James to recover in Value against the said Nicholas
       and Mary and for the said Nicholas and Mary to Recover in Value against
       the Common Vouchee, to the end one perfect Common Recovery with double
       Voucher may be thereupon had and suffered and all and every other thing and
       things be done and perfected needfull and Convenient for the having & suffering
       the same Recovery according to the Course of Common Recoverys in such
       Cases Used And the same Recovery is also to be Executed by one Writ of
       Habere facias Seisinam accordingly And it is hereby further Covenanted
       Concluded and Agreed by and between the said parties to these Presents for
       themselves and every of them their and every of their Heirs that the said
       Recovery so as aforesaid or in any other manner to be had and suffered of
       the said Messuage Tenement Lands and Premisses above mentioned shall
